The Role
In this position, you will support students with complex Social, Emotional, and Mental Health needs. Many students may have experienced trauma or have associated needs such as ASD or ADHD. You will lead a small classroom (typically 5-8 students) with high staff-to-pupil ratios, ensuring every child receives the intensive support they require to flourish.
Key Responsibilities
- Differentiated Instruction: Create highly personalised learning pathways that cater to various academic levels and emotional needs.
- Emotional Regulation: Implement proactive strategies to help students manage their emotions and de-escalate challenging situations.
- Progress Monitoring: Use both academic and EHCP (Educational Health and Care Plan) targets to measure success.
- Collaborative Working: Partner with LSAs, social workers, and parents to provide a consistent, 360-degree support system for each learner.
